Transaction 423eb62f62e0717650e98f1489a2b5c82534e41d22d539b276f18a37e2ca51d4
1 Input
2 Outputs
- 423eb62f62e0717650e98f1489a2b5c82534e41d22d539b276f18a37e2ca51d4:0
- 423eb62f62e0717650e98f1489a2b5c82534e41d22d539b276f18a37e2ca51d4:1
value 1246939
address 13NMSgux7KvYYKdJjD4sx13pkpKMmwTveq
value 647187
address 16DP9RmYigpmHCfEDmLA23b7b94LixJLHn